Upright Bike
Pros: Mimics the feeling of outdoor biking.Compact style fits well in smaller spaces.Cons:May cause discomfort in the lower back or buttocks after extended use.
Recumbent Bike
Pros:Provides much better lumbar assistance, reducing strain on the back.Easier on the knees, making it appropriate for rehabilitation.Cons:Takes up more space compared to upright models.Less intense workout due to easier riding position.
Spin Bike
Pros:Offers a robust workout, typically incorporating interval training.Customizable saddle and handlebars for ideal comfort.Cons:Can be rather costly; greater end models may be needed for serious cyclists.Needs some adjustment for novices.
Air Bike

When buying an exercise bike, it's important to examine different functions that can improve your workout experience. Here's a list of crucial features to consider:
Resistance Levels: Look for bikes that provide multiple resistance levels to challenge yourself as your physical fitness enhances.
Adjustability: Ensure the seat and handlebars can be adapted to fit your height for a comfortable trip.
Display Console: Many bikes come geared up with a digital display to track metrics like speed, range, time, and calories burned.
Connection: Some exercise bikes provide Bluetooth connection for integration with fitness apps, boosting your workout tracking.
Integrated Workouts: Consider bikes with pre-set exercise programs to help vary your routine.
Weight Capacity: Check the maximum user weight limitation to make sure the bike is tough enough for your needs.
Service warranty: A strong guarantee can provide peace of mind regarding durability and reliability.
Upkeep Tips for Exercise Bikes
Routine upkeep is important for making sure the durability of your exercise bike. Here are some suggestions to keep your bike in optimum condition:
Keep it Clean: Wipe down the bike after each use to eliminate sweat and dust.
Tighten Screws and Bolts: Periodically examine screws and bolts to guarantee they are securely secured.
Lube Moving Parts: Apply lube to the moving parts to reduce wear and tear.
Inspect the Drive Belt: Check for wear and tear and change as necessary.
Shop Properly: If you live in a damp environment, think about covering the bike or storing it in a dry location to prevent rust.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. What is the difference in between an upright bike and a recumbent bike?
An upright bike has a more standard biking position, which can enhance core muscles and imitate outside biking. A recumbent bike has a reclined seat that offers back support, making it simpler on the joints and suitable for longer exercises.
2. How much should I invest in a stationary bicycle?
Costs can vary from a couple of hundred dollars to several thousand. For a great quality bike, anticipate to spend at least ₤ 300 to ₤ 700. Higher-end models, especially spin bikes, can cost upwards of ₤ 1000.
3. How often should I use my exercise bike for ideal results?
For general fitness, go for 150 minutes of moderate aerobic activity per week, or about 30 minutes a day, five days a week. For weight-loss or performance goals, you may wish to increase this period or intensity.
4. Can a stationary bicycle assist with weight loss?
Yes, exercise bikes can be reliable tools for weight loss when combined with a balanced diet plan and a constant workout routine. The key is to maintain an adequate level of strength to burn calories.
